Specifications of Dermal Microtemp Sensors

Dermal Microtemp Sensors are designed for precision, flexibility, and real-time feedback. These ultra-thin, skin-mounted sensors use advanced materials to provide non-invasive, accurate heat monitoring.

Feature Specification
Sensor Type Flexible Microthermal Sensor
Thickness < 100 microns
Temperature Accuracy ±0.1°C
Connectivity Wireless (Bluetooth LE)
Battery Life Up to 24 hours continuous monitoring
Material Biocompatible, skin-safe polymer

These specifications make the Dermal Microtemp Sensor ideal for health monitoring, fitness applications, and clinical use where precision is critical.

Performance and Benchmark Data

Performance is at the core of Dermal Microtemp Sensors. Rigorous lab and field tests have been conducted to ensure their accuracy and responsiveness under various conditions.

Test Condition Result Notes
Baseline Skin Temp Monitoring ±0.1°C accuracy Compared to clinical thermometers
Response Time Within 2 seconds After thermal stimulus applied
Long Duration Use (8 hours) No signal degradation Stable performance throughout
Movement Impact < 0.5°C fluctuation During normal activity

These results highlight the sensor’s ability to deliver consistent, real-time data—even in dynamic environments like sports or clinical settings.

FAQ (Frequently Asked Questions)

How do Dermal Microtemp Sensors attach to the skin?

They use hypoallergenic adhesive or are integrated into skin-safe patches.

Are they reusable?

Some models are reusable with proper sanitization; others are designed for single-use.

Do they require calibration?

Factory calibration is standard, though professional use may require occasional recalibration.

Can they connect to mobile apps?

Yes, most come with companion apps or APIs for integration.

Are they safe for children or infants?

Yes, as long as they are labeled pediatric-safe and used under supervision.

How long can they operate continuously?

Typically up to 24 hours per session, depending on battery life.
